Behavioral outcome measures in preclinical rodent models for postoperative pain: A protocol for a systematic review and quantitative meta-analysis

Abstract

Abstract Background Understanding the (patho-) physiology of pain after surgery is incomplete; this hampers the effective treatment and leads to long-term consequences, including complications, chronification of pain, and potential drug misuse. Evidence-based research is essential to discover novel therapeutic options. Rodent models for postoperative pain have been developed to widen the knowledge about mechanisms and improve translation. These models cause evoked and non-evoked pain-related behaviors with specific duration, intensity, and timing expressions but with differences between studies. Reasons are heterogeneously performed (and/or reported) behavioral assays making it challenging to compare results across studies. Furthermore, indices about the influencing role of animal-related factors like age, sex, or the experimental setting are given. However, most of them were not systematically investigated, e.g., for pain-related behavior in rodent models of postoperative pain. Therefore, this review will systematically examine pain-related behaviour in different postoperative models in rodents. Acquisition of publication and experimental level characteristics will identify possible confounding and multilevel bias factors on results. Methods Four databases will be screened, and results will be compared for duplicates by automated and manual screening. Publication and experimental level characteristics will be extracted to (1) determine methodological aspects and use frequency of postoperative pain models and pain-related behavioral outcomes, (2) generate model-dependent behavior profiles, and (3) identify and critically evaluate confounder and bias factors on outcome measures and results. Discussion Findings from this study are necessary to inform researchers and improve future studies in design, performance, analysis, and ethical and translational aspects. Systematic review registration: Submitted to PROSPERO
